Polish

Etymology

Borrowed from French garniture, from Middle French garniture, from Old French garneture, garnesture, from garnir.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ɡarˈɲi.tur/
  • (file)
  • Rhymes: -itur
  • Syllabification: gar‧ni‧tur

Noun

garnitur m inan (diminutive garniturek)

  1. suit, lounge suit
    Synonym: gajer
  2. ensemble (group of separate things that contribute to a coordinated whole)
  3. a group of people who have similar competence in the same areas
